How much interest does the DenizBank DenizBank Tagesgeld pay?
DenizBank offers the flexible savings account "DenizBank Tagesgeld" with annually interest payouts. The regular interest rate is 1.5%. You must maintain a balance of at least 100 euros.
Who is behind DenizBank?
DenizBank AG is the Austrian subsidiary of DenizBank A.Ş., an international banking group with roots in Turkey and operations across several countries.
In Germany, DenizBank offers financial products for consumers and businesses. This includes deposit products, credit and financing, and international transfer solutions. DenizBank AG operates as a licensed credit institution under Austrian banking supervision.
How safe is my money with DenizBank?
Deposits held with DenizBank AG are protected under the statutory Austrian deposit guarantee scheme, the (Einlagensicherung AUSTRIA), up to 100,000 euros per depositor and bank in line with EU law.
Austria's sovereign credit rating is powerful (AA+), showing the overall stability and solvency of the Austrian state.
How can I manage the DenizBank Tagesgeld account?
The "DenizBank Tagesgeld" is managed through DenizBank's online banking platform or mobile app for Android and iOS. Customers can, i.e., choose new investments, view balances, and transfer funds.
The website, online application, and mobile app are available in 3 languages: German, English, and Turkish. Customer service is available via telephone and email.
How can I open the DenizBank DenizBank Tagesgeld?
The "DenizBank Tagesgeld" can be opened via an online application on the bank's website. Applicants must be at least 18 years old and reside in Germany to access the German product portfolio. All customers first open a clearing account, which serves as the hub for all transactions and investments with DenizBank. Once you have opened the clearing account, you can easily open the DenizBank flexible savings account and other options, as well as receive money or transfer money to other banks.
As part of the onboarding process for the "DenizBank Tagesgeld", identity verification is performed. This can be carried out online (VideoIdent) or at a German post office (PostIdent).
